Michigan rules that this document follows
| Nonpayment of rent | 7 days — 7-Day Demand for Possession for Nonpayment of Rent (DC 100a)Source: Mich. Comp. Laws § 554.134(2) |
|---|---|
| Lease violation | 30 days — no statutory right to cureSource: Mich. Comp. Laws § 554.134(1); § 600.5714(1)(c) |
| Unconditional quit | 7 days — Serious and continuing health hazard or extensive physical damage (7 days, § 600.5714(1)(d)); illegal drug activity on premises (24 hours, § 554.134(4))Source: Mich. Comp. Laws § 600.5714(1)(d); § 554.134(4) |
| Permitted service methods | Personal delivery to the tenant; Delivery to a person of suitable age at the premises + first-class mail; First-class mail; Electronic delivery (only if the lease authorizes it)Source: Mich. Comp. Laws § 600.5718 (personal delivery, leaving with household member 18+ with request to deliver, first-class mail, or electronic service if agreed in writing) |
| Required content | Demand for possession must state the amount due (nonpayment) or the reason for termination, the deadline, and that the tenant may be evicted if they do not comply; SCAO forms DC 100a/100c contain the required content. |
| Statute | Mich. Comp. Laws § 554.134; Summary Proceedings § 600.5701 et seq. |

Is it valid in Michigan?
The template follows the Michigan rules listed on this page (reviewed September 2026). A blank form becomes a binding document only once it is completed correctly and signed by the parties. Check the state facts below and consider an attorney for unusual situations.
Should I fill it by hand or online?
Online is safer: the generator applies Michigan limits and notice periods, validates your entries and produces a clean PDF and Word file. Filling by hand works for simple cases — write clearly, initial every page and keep a signed copy for each party.
